An affidavit in Pune is a written sworn statement, drafted on stamp paper and attested by a notary, used as evidence before courts, government departments, banks, and educational institutions. Adv. Sayali G. Chavan drafts and attests affidavits for name change, address proof, income, marital status, gap certificates, lost-document declarations, and dozens of other purposes — written correctly the first time.

What is the cost of an affidavit in Pune?+

Costs depend on stamp paper denomination (usually ₹100–₹500) and notary attestation fee. Standard affidavits typically range from ₹300 to ₹900 total. We provide a clear quote before drafting.

Can an affidavit be drafted in Marathi?+

Yes. We draft affidavits in English, Marathi, or Hindi depending on the receiving authority. Government and court submissions in Pune commonly accept both English and Marathi.

How long is an affidavit valid?+

An affidavit doesn't expire by date, but the receiving authority may require it to be issued within a recent window (often 3–6 months). Check with the department where you'll submit it.
